About

"How to Keep Bees" is a detailed and accessible guide to bee-keeping and apiary management, with information on starting out, constructing an apiary, acquiring bees, and much more. Written in simple, plain language and profusely illustrated, this comprehensive handbook constitutes a must-have for modern readers with practical interest in the subject. Contents include: "Introduction", "Pasturage", "Location of the Hives", "Hives", "Frames, Supers, Etc.", "Honey Boards", "Bee Escapes", "Drone and Queen Trap", "Smoker", "Foundation Fasteners", "Honey Extractor", "Hove Tools", "Comb Foundation", "Clothing", "Uniformity of Appliances", "Making a Start", etc. Many vintage books such as this are becoming increasingly scarce and expensive. We are republishing this volume now in an affordable, modern, high-quality edition complete with a specially commissioned new introduction on Bee-keeping.
